Must-Try Dishes in Nha Trang

During your Yolo Hopping Tour, you’ll have the opportunity to savor some of Nha Trang’s most iconic dishes. Here are a few must-try suggestions to whet your appetite:

1. Banh Xeo (Crispy Rice Pancake): This savory pancake is made with a batter of rice flour, turmeric, and coconut milk, and filled with a mixture of pork, shrimp, and vegetables. It’s typically served with fresh herbs and a dipping sauce.

2. Nem Nuong Nha Trang (Grilled Pork Skewers): These skewers of marinated pork are grilled to perfection and served with a sweet and tangy dipping sauce. They’re a popular street food snack and a great introduction to the flavors of Nha Trang.

3. Bun Cha Ca (Fish Noodle Soup): This comforting noodle soup is made with a flavorful broth, rice noodles, fish cakes, and fresh vegetables. It’s a hearty and satisfying dish that’s perfect for a quick meal.

4. Banh Canh Cha Ca (Fish Noodle Cake): Similar to Bun Cha Ca, this dish features rice noodles, but instead of being served in a soup, it’s served with a thick, savory sauce made with fish. It’s a unique and delicious twist on the classic noodle soup.


5. Oc Nhoi Thit (Stuffed Snails): These snails are stuffed with a mixture of pork, mushrooms, and herbs, then grilled and served with a tangy dipping sauce. They’re a popular appetizer and a must-try for seafood lovers.

6. Chao Tom (Shrimp Porridge): This creamy porridge is made with shrimp, rice, and vegetables. It’s a comforting and nourishing dish that’s often eaten for breakfast or as a light snack.

7. Hoa Qua Dam (Preserved Fruit): This sweet and sour dessert is made with a variety of tropical fruits, such as papaya, mango, and pineapple, that have been preserved in a syrup. It’s a popular treat and a great way to end your meal on a sweet note.

8. Ca Nai Rang (Grilled Mackerel): This grilled mackerel is marinated in a mixture of spices and herbs, giving it a unique and flavorful taste. It’s typically served with rice or noodles.

9. Banh Khot (Miniature Pancakes): These bite-sized pancakes are made with a batter of rice flour and coconut milk, and filled with a variety of ingredients, such as shrimp, pork, or quail eggs. They’re typically served with a dipping sauce.

10. Banh Beo (Steamed Rice Cakes): These delicate rice cakes are steamed and topped with a variety of ingredients, such as shrimp, pork, or mushrooms. They’re a popular snack and a good way to sample a variety of flavors.
